When did the United States become part of the United Nations

The United States was a founding member of the United Nations, and was heavily involved in its planning and creation. The United Nations was a response to the devastation of World War 2, and thus was founded shortly after. 

The United Nations was first convened on <span>25 April 1945 in San Francisco, and naturally the United States was present. 

The United Nations was officially established on 24 October 1945, and the United States was a founding member, officially joining on the date of its creation. </span>

How are the landforms of europe both an advantage and disadvantage
dlinn [17]

Answer:

Among the advantages we can name the fact that across most Europe there are fertile soils, long river systems, the terrain makes traveling easy and therefore more open to trade since there are no physical borders.

However, this same factor turns into a serious disadvantage in times of war. The lack of physical borders makes countries easier to invade, as was probed in the numerous cities captured by the Nazi regime in WWII. Disease transmissions and undesired immigration are also a frequent problem with open borders.
